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
384580867 618 69665 41 4754021
7942502002 45699136271
7942502002 45699136271
63759336 522077030 05871 14
All about undefined
Interested in learning more?
7942502002 45699136271
63759336 522077030 05871 14
See more
05958 44
72470759 7217958771 6106156
See more
20665043720 123083 2559503
272448807 66942455135 2200
See more